Karl Marx was one of the greatest advocates of socialism. socialism may be defined as a social, economic and political system in which the state owns and controls the means of productionexchange and distribution ofgoods and services. The main aim of Socialism is to ensure equal distributionof the nation's wealth. Countries that practise this economic system (known as theSecond World) include:1. Russia2. Czechoslovakia3 Bulgaria4. China5. Cuba6. Romania7. Albania8. Poland9. The German Democratic Republic. Some Africancourtries that have also practised this system at one time or the otherinclude:1. Tanzania2. Ethiopia3. Angola4. Burkina F^iso5. Guinea 6. Mozambique etc. Socialist economy isbased on the central planning of all' economic activities as opposed to thecapitalist market price mechanism otherwise called capitalism. Karl Marx, aGerman (1818-1883) was the founder and propounder of modern socialism.The collaborator of Karl Marx in developing modernsocicilism was Friedrich Engels (1882-1895). Vladimer Lenin led his Bolshevik faction of the RussianSocial-Democratic Party (now known as the Communist Party of Russia) to carryout the Socialist Revolution.That was in 1917 in the defunct Union of SovietSocialist Republic (USSR).
